Compound A, C11H12O, which gave a negative Tollens test, was treated with LiAlH4, followed by dilute acid, to give compound B, which could be resolved into enantiomers. When optically active B was treated with CrO3 in pyridine, an optically inactive sample of A was obtained. Heating A with hydrazine in base gave hydrocarbon C, which, when heated with alkaline KMnO4, gave carboxylic acid D. Identify compounds A, B, and C.
